Real Experience in Financial Communication Challenges

Over the past eight years, we've worked with finance teams facing the same recurring problems: misaligned stakeholder expectations, unclear budget presentations, and communication breakdowns during critical decision periods.

These aren't theoretical scenarios. They're situations we've navigated alongside professionals who needed practical solutions, not academic concepts.

What We've Learned

Communication failures in finance rarely stem from technical knowledge gaps. They usually happen when context gets lost, assumptions go unchecked, or the audience receives information in ways they can't easily process.
